5 Ideas for Meals Using a Slow Cooker
A slow cooker is one of those kitchen appliances that can not seem necessary at first, but once you have one, you wonder how you ever did without it. Professionals to shift workers at the busy mom, the slow cooker is the answer to the population time poor who do not want to sacrifice the quality of their meals to their busy lifestyles. A slow cooker allows you to throw a certain number of carefully selected ingredients and come home for a meal that has simmered slowly for a long period. Anyone who knows the food will always know what a great meal. Make a meal on a budget can be difficult if you eat fast food and low in fat because it relies on quality ingredients and freshly prepared. Cooking on a budget, however, often means that food must be cooked a little more to soften the cuts of meat and allows flavors to deepen simple so a slow cooker is perfect for cooking on a budget. cheaper cuts of meat are often more expensive than the tasty parts. Lamschenkels, osso bucco, beef and ham Chuck are known for their flavor and often appear on menus.
Cooking on a Budget
Boeuf bourguignon – using chuck steak, a basic choice of vegetables, wine and bacon can be a classic French chef.
Moroccan lamb tagine – lamschenkels with a choice of vegetables and herbs can be a carefully selected exotic and tasty feast.
Ragu Traditional Italian – the use of chopped pork and beef can rustle of an authentic Italian Bolognese, tomato, onion, carrot, wine and broth. The long slow cooking, the flavors to develop in the most delicious spaghetti bolognese that you have ever done.
Irish Stew – you can use cheap parts lamb or beef to make this classic pub. Again, you only need some basic vegetables, broth and a lot of time in a slow oven and enjoy this tasty meal economical when you go home.
Soups
Most soups benefit from long slow cooking is why a slow cooker is ideal for winter meals hot and tasty to make.
Try the following suggestions for soups that will benefit from a pot;
Mulligatawny soup, a curry English soup, beef and barley soup, steak and Chuck that melt-in-your-mouth Italian Minestrone become rich and flavorful base for long cooking, or a rustic bean soup will develop with the beans, which become creamy when cooked slowly.
Desserts
Who would have thought that the slow cooker can make a dessert? Like a furnace to extract a creamy rice pudding slow cooker apple pie light and crumbly, or how about chocolate fudge pudding? Any traditional English puddings steamed will cook very well in a casserole.
As for meals, slow cookers are limited only by your imagination. So go online and find recipes that match endless simmering stews of meat to bread pudding.
